A guided walk through vegetable gardens, cultivated fields and lagoon landscapes, with a visit to the beehives of Azienda Agricola Valleri and tasting of local products.
Every Friday at 5:45 p.m., enjoy a journey that brings together nature, farming and local flavours in the rural heart of Cavallino-Treporti.
The route starts at the Valleri Farm car park with a loop walk of about 2 km, led by a certified Environmental Hiking Guide (AIGAE). Along the way, you’ll cross cultivated fields and reach the scenic pedestrian and cycle path suspended over the lagoon — the perfect spot to admire sunset colours and observe local wildlife and vegetation.
After about 40 minutes, the group returns to the starting point for a guided visit to the farm’s beehive area. A short talk, supported by educational materials, will introduce the world of bees and their vital role in biodiversity and agriculture.
The evening ends with a local tasting at the agritourism. Those who purchased the 25€ package with aperitif (available for ages 13 and up) will enjoy three cicchetti (small local bites) paired with an aperitif, also available in a non-alcoholic version.
A children’s package is available for €6, to be paid directly at the Agriturismo.
